Before and After School Club Manager

Manage, supervise and support Out of School Club staff to ensure a high level of service
Attend and participate in meetings to ensure the smooth running of the club
Support Trustees to draw up an annual Out of School Club Development Plan and help monitor
progress
Ensure awareness and knowledge of club policies/procedures
Create a stimulating, clean and safe environment, including the outdoor area
Create a detailed, weekly plan of play activities which are appropriate, varied and enjoyable, to support the development of children's skills and experiences
Monitor and evaluate children's responses to activities through observation evaluating and adjusting activities, as appropriate to meet the needs of the children
Ensure appropriate staff ratios are maintained at all times, maintaining rotas of work for all staff and liaising with the Charity Trustees about staff absences
Working within the agreed budget, order appropriate supplies as necessary
Maintain appropriate records for attendance and payment of fees
Help to create a welcoming and supportive environment for the pupils attending the club.
Be responsible for the management of the behaviour of pupils attending the club.
Assist with the tidying of the venue after use and ensure the secure storage of resources and equipment
Support the development of pupils with special educational needs and/or disabilities.
